About Patong

Patong beach, Phuket, back in the 80’s, was a sleepy Thai fishing village. Bangla Road (the strip) was a semi paved, barely two lane piece of road that ran from the beach to the intersection. Beer was around 25 or 30 baht also and Thai fishing boats still anchored by the score very close to the beach at night. How things have changed!Today Patong Beach is one of the most famous destinations in the world and better known for its nightlife and the 3.5 kilometers (2.2 mi) beach that runs the entire length of Patong’s road side.Nightlife is centered in two main areas, ‘Bangla Road’ but there are hundreds of bars, cafes and restaurants around Patong waiting for you to walk in. What is the weather like by The Baray Villa by Sawasdee Village and Patong?

The weather around The Baray Villa by Sawasdee Village on Phuket in Thailand is warm all year round. However, the weather is generally most pleasant from late December to March, or even May, when there are clear skies and sunshine. The “hot season” is from April to May, when temperatures reach their highest. The main “rainy season”, or monsoon season, is between May / June and November, or even as late as December over the last decade or so.

Can a foreigner purchase properties in Patong, or Phuket, Thailand?

The short answer is yes. Generally, the key requirements for buying properties or Real Estate around Patong on Phuket island, Thailand are the following: A) A deposit of 10% to 20% of total price to be paid on the 'Promise of Sale' (before signing the final contract). B) A foreign buyer has two options: either a 30-year leasehold or purchasing the property through a limited company. Patong Apartments can be purchased by foreigners as long as at least 51% of the building is owned by Thais. C) Stamp duty is normally 0.50% of the total price. D) Registration fee between 2% and 2.5% of total Patong property price plus agent fee. It is also important to know that if you are a non-Thai citizen, you may be subject to specific regulations and in certain instances be required to hold a specific permit enabling you to acquire Patong or Phuket, Thailand property. This does not apply to properties situated within special designated areas, such as developments on Phuket island in Thailand. Is it OK to drink water from the tap in The Baray Villa by Sawasdee Village, or around Patong on Phuket, Thailand?

Personally I do NOT drink water from the tap on Phuket island, but they say you can? I suggest that you buy 6 pack bottled water from any local Patong mini market around the The Baray Villa by Sawasdee Village for drinking. The cheap clear, none branded, bottles, to me, are the best. I do though, as with other expats and locals around Patong, brush my teeth with tap water, and use it for making tea / coffee etc, but only after boiling a few times. If you are unsure when you arrive to the The Baray Villa by Sawasdee Village, stick to the bottled water.

How much is a print of beer or larger in around the The Baray Villa by Sawasdee Village or Patong?

The beer or larger prices around The Baray Villa by Sawasdee Village or Patong on Phuket in Thailand is: Domestic Beer (0.5 liter draught) is around 70 / 90.00฿ while Imported Beer (0.33 liter bottle) will be around 100.00 ฿. Nightclubs, and higher end venues can be a lot more and supermarkets / mini markets will be a bit cheaper. Check out the 'Happy Hour' signs as you walk or drive by. Most bars will have them.
